Who can shoot at Bisley?

There is no minimum age limit for minors to shoot on Bisley ranges. However, for minors under the age of 14 an application for permission to shoot must be made to the NRA well in advance of the planned visit. This does not affect any cadet or other recognised youth organisations whilst shooting at an official event.

How do I join the Bisley shooting club?

New Shooters and lapsed Members who wish to be considered for Bisley Gun Club membership must shoot at least three times at a registered Saturday or Sunday shoot before being proposed and seconded by fully paid up members of the Club and the application form then submitted for approval by the Club Secretary.

What is Bisley famous for?

shooting circles
Bisley is famous within shooting circles and has a long history. Some of the buildings within the grounds are from the Victorian era, having been transported there in the re-location from Wimbledon Common.

What is the Bisley competition?

“Bisley”, as the competition is often called, is held over a two-week period each summer and involves, most notably, the Army Operational Shooting Competition for Regular Force matches, and the Army Reserve Operational Shooting Competition (AROSC).
